
What we’re about
Men of all ages who enjoy amateur photography are welcome to participate. I already host a mixed walking group so now am interested to see how the male dynamic works in a photography environment. Based in Malahide. The group will meet up fortnightly. Two coastal locations and two parkland locations. Walk duration about an hour and a half stopping to shoot when ever, where ever. Finish with an optional drink in a local bar to discuss the shoot. Later, optional to edit your selected photographs to post on Flickr. Set up your own Flickr for free.
Happy-go-lucky Men Photographers is different. While we work hard to improve our work, we don't take ourselves too seriously. The ethos is to learn more than compete with each other. Of course the competitive spirit drives learning for many of us too!
There is a place in Happy-go-lucky for the man with the camera and all the paraphenalia. There is also a place for the man who snaps with his phone. In Happy-go-lucky men who can appraise images are equal in importance to those action types who like to Walk & Shoot
